Canadian annual home sales surged in November, with prices rising as interest rates fall | CBC News
Briefly

CREA senior economist Shaun Cathcart highlighted, "Not only were sales up again, but with market conditions now starting to tighten up, November also saw prices move materially higher at the national level for the first time in almost a year and a half..."
Clay Jarvis from NerdWallet Canada stated, "With variable rates down and inventory up, buyers are striking before the iron gets hot, predicting that the spring season will be competitive."
